Logo (March 15, 1951)

Visuals: Over a grey background is the text "K&K" in a stylized font surrounded by a bunch of sunrays. There is also the 3D text "PRODUCTIONS" below "K&K", being in the matter of light streaks. Below all of that is the word "Present" in a script font.

Technique: A painting filmed by a cameraman.

Audio: The opening theme of the film.

Availability: Seen only on Jeevitha Nouka.
